1. Fold It in Half. Take a single wrapper and fold it longways, or hot-dog style. Do this three times. Try to fold the jagged edge inside because it can get in the way when making the chains. Then, fold it through the middle. 2. Fold It Through the Middle. Foil wrapped chewing gum can light your fire or bbq. Great if you haven't got a lighter. First, you make ignitor strips using the wrapper from a stick of gum. Shave a bit off of each of the sides of the wrapper, creating a bridge about 2mm wide in the middle. One strip can yield about three ignitors. jon 90 day fiance brothercinema arts movie theater fairfax Music: https://www.bensound.com/royalty-free-music publix 301 This pattern reminded me of the gum wrapper chains and I loved it!
